This talk offers a unique take on the creation of the People's Republic of China, arguing that 1949 was a turning point for the nation and, as a result, changed the course of world history. With the dramatic collapse of Chiang Kai-shek's 'pro-Western' Nationalist government, overthrown by Mao Zedong and his communist armies, the events of this pivotal year reverberated across the world, resulting in long-lasting consequences that are still being felt today.

Graham Hutchings follows the huge military forces that tramped across the country, the exile of once-powerful leaders and the alarm of the foreign powers watching on. Shadowing both the leaders and the people of China in 1949, Hutchings reveals the lived experiences, aftermath and consequences of this singular year; one in which careers were made and ruined, and popular hopes for a 'new China' contrasted with fears that it would change the country forever.

Hutchings' book China 1949 (Bloomsbury 2020) is a vivid, gripping account of the year in which China abruptly changed course and pulled the rest of world history along with it.
